About Copacabana
Copacabana is a seafood restaurant and Brazilian restaurant in Al Wakrah, Qatar, located in Souq Al Wakra near Al Wakra Beach. Reviewers consistently praise the fresh fish, especially fish bbq, seabass, sea bream, and mandi rice, along with the ability to choose seasoning or masala flavors. The restaurant offers outdoor and rooftop seating, and many reviews mention the beach view, friendly staff, and attentive recommendations. Prices are in the QAR 50 to 100 range, and the setting is described as casual, cozy, quiet, and trendy.

Frequently asked questions
What is Copacabana known for?
Copacabana is best known for fresh seafood, especially fish bbq, seabass, and sea bream served with your choice of seasoning or masala. Reviewers also repeatedly mention the mandi rice and the beach view at Souq Al Wakra as part of the experience.
What dishes are most recommended at Copacabana?
The most recommended items are the sea bass with Arabic masala, sea bream with lemon, fish bbq, and the mix plate. Reviewers also call out crab bechamel and grilled king fish, with several noting that the seafood tastes fresh and is cooked well.
What is the atmosphere like at Copacabana?
The atmosphere is described as casual, cozy, quiet, and trendy, with outdoor, terrace, and rooftop seating overlooking Al Wakra Beach. It seems to suit groups and families as well as solo diners, since reviews mention both family dinners and relaxed meals for one.
Is Copacabana good value, and what is the price range?
Copacabana sits in the QAR 50 to 100 range, and reviewers often describe the meal as satisfying and worth it for the freshness of the seafood and the attentive service. Several compare it favorably with other nearby seafood spots, especially when ordering grilled fish plates and rice.
What should I know about the service and seating before visiting Copacabana?
The staff is frequently praised for being friendly, knowledgeable about fish, and helpful with recommendations, and some reviews mention prompt service and complimentary red tea. If you want the best view, ask for terrace or second-floor seating, since reviews specifically mention looking out toward Al Wakra Beach.
